What types of immigration cases do Santa Barbara attorneys commonly handle?
Santa Barbara immigration attorneys frequently handle cases involving H-1B visas for professionals at local institutions like UCSB and Cottage Health, investor visas for entrepreneurs, family-based petitions for mixed-status families in the area, and DACA renewals for local students and workers. Given Santa Barbara's agricultural industry, many attorneys also have experience with seasonal agricultural worker petitions and related immigration matters specific to the Central Coast region.
How can I find affordable immigration legal services in Santa Barbara?
Several organizations in Santa Barbara provide low-cost or pro bono immigration services, including the Santa Barbara County Immigrant Legal Defense Center and the Central Coast Alliance United for a Sustainable Economy (CAUSE). Additionally, many private immigration attorneys in Santa Barbara offer sliding scale fees based on income, and the Santa Barbara Public Defender's Office may provide referrals to affordable legal resources for immigration matters.
What should I look for when choosing an immigration attorney in Santa Barbara?
When selecting an immigration attorney in Santa Barbara, verify they're members of the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A) and check their standing with the California State Bar. Look for attorneys with specific experience in cases similar to yours, whether it's employment-based visas for local tech and hospitality industries, family petitions, or removal defense. Many successful Santa Barbara immigration lawyers have established relationships with local USCIS offices and understand the specific procedural nuances of our regional immigration courts.
Are there any local Santa Barbara resources that can help with my immigration case?
Yes, Santa Barbara offers several local resources including the Santa Barbara County Immigrant Defense Center, which provides legal representation, and the Santa Barbara Public Library's legal reference services. The UCSB Department of Chicana and Chicano Studies also maintains connections with immigration advocacy groups. Additionally, many community organizations like MICOP (Mixteco/Indigena Community Organizing Project) serve indigenous immigrant populations in the Santa Barbara area with legal support and resources.
How does Santa Barbara's location affect immigration court proceedings?
Santa Barbara residents typically have their immigration cases heard at the Los Angeles Immigration Court, which requires travel for hearings. However, many Santa Barbara immigration attorneys are familiar with this court's procedures and judges. For certain applications, you may need to visit the USCIS field office in San Fernando Valley, though some limited services are available at the Application Support Center in Santa Barbara. Experienced local attorneys can help navigate these logistical challenges specific to our region.
